Carlos Puyol expecting tough Champions League test for Barcelona

Former Barcelona defender Carlos Puyol looks ahead to the Spanish side's Champions League last-16 clash with Manchester City.

Former Barcelona defender Carlos Puyol has claimed that the Catalan outfit will have to be at their best to overcome Manchester City in the last-16 stage of the Champions League.

The Spaniard, who currently acts as assistant to the director of football Andoni Zubizarreta at Camp Nou, believes that the clash will pit "two of the favourites" against each other.

"There's a long way to go to February and a lot of things can happen," said Puyol after picking up the Career Achievement prize at the AS awards.

"We'll have to wait until then, it's going to be a clash between two of Europe's biggest teams, two of the favourites."

The first leg will take place at the Etihad.
